Property Description

Damson Cottage is a pretty, individual detached stone-built home, believed to date from around 1790. This delightful property beautifully combines period character with modern comfort, offering flexible and adaptable living space ideal for a variety of lifestyles. This property has been significantly improved by the current owners to create a welcoming and versatile home full of warmth and charm. The accommodation benefits from gas-fired central heating, new external doors, high performance double glazing throughout, comfortable living room with exposed beams and a feature fireplace housing a woodburning stove that creates a cosy focal point, a spacious kitchen/diner, ideal for everyday living and entertaining and a versatile second reception room, currently used as a bedroom, which could equally serve as a sitting room, study, or formal dining area. Upstairs offers further flexibility with a well-proportioned bedroom and a spacious landing area, suitable as an occasional bedroom or guest area. With minor adjustments, the landing could be converted into a small additional bedroom or home office. A stylish new bathroom completes the accommodation, fitted with contemporary fixtures and finishes. Externally, Damson Cottage enjoys parking for two vehicles and a wonderful covered outdoor seating area, perfect for year-round enjoyment. The gardens include a mix of lawn and planting, with a delightful countryside outlook, providing both privacy and a peaceful setting. occupying a prominent position on Bourton Road,, the property is within easy reach of the picturesque town centre of Much Wenlock, with its array of independent shops, cafés, and historic landmarks. The area is surrounded by beautiful Shropshire countryside, with excellent walking routes and easy access to Ironbridge, Bridgnorth, and Shrewsbury.
